Course Description

Motion is a fundamental property of the universe. It’s a kind of puzzle because every object in the universe is in motion. During this 2-week camp, we’ll explore science and engineering in motion through hands-on activities, observations, and experiments. You will work individually, as well as in cooperative teams, to complete tasks in a specified amount of time. Experience what it might be like to work as a scientist or engineer in a fun, summer camp setting with other fellow STEM enthusiasts.
